GeoSim

GeoSim is an add-on for generating photorealistic, customizable planets in Blender. It utilizes a dedicated shader nodegroup to produce physically-based volumetric atmospheres, providing direct control over attributes like atmospheric density, thickness, ambient light, and color via Mie scattering. The tool is compatible with both EEVEE and Cycles render engines.

The system includes support for image-based volumetric clouds that cast dynamic shadows on the atmosphere. It accommodates standard PBR workflows with full texture support for albedo, roughness, specular, normal, and emission maps. Additional capabilities include terrain displacement, indirect lighting, depth of field support, and a day/night emission mask to automatically disable city lights in daylight areas. The add-on also includes a set of Earth textures sourced from NASA, ranging from 2k to 16k resolution.
